
Saint Augustine, a painting by Carlo Crivelli, dates from 1490-1500. It is part of the Palazzo Colonna collection. The image shows a detail of the painting, specifically a panel depicting Saint Augustine in a richly carved frame. The saint is shown in full length, wearing a mitre and bishop's robes, holding a crosier. The background is relatively simple, suggesting a room or niche. The frame is ornately carved with Gothic-style details. The size of the complete artwork is not specified in the provided metadata.
